BACTERIA

Bacteria - small one celled monerans

Bacteria like a warm, dark, and moist environment

They are found almost everywhere:

-water -air

-soil -food

-skin -inside the body

-on most objects

•Binary Fission- the process of one organism dividing into two organisms

•Fission is a type of asexual reproduction

Reproduction of Bacteria

How?... The one main (circular) chromosome makes a copy of itself Then it divides into two

•Asexual reproduction- reproduction of a living thing from only one parent

15

BINARY FISSION

Bacteria dividing Completed

Reproduction of Bacteria

16

•The time of reproduction depends on how desirable the conditions are

•Bacteria can rapidly reproduce themselves in warm, dark, and moist conditions

•Some can reproduce every 20 minutes (one bacteria could be an ancestor to one million bacteria in six hours)

Reproduction of Bacteria

Bacteria Survival

Endospore- •a thick celled structure that forms inside the cell

•they are the major cause of food poisoning

•they can withstand boiling, freezing, and extremely dry conditions

•it encloses all the nuclear materials and some cytoplasm

•allows the bacteria to survive for many years

19

Bacillus subtilis

Endospore-the black section in the middle

highly resistant structures

can withstand radiation, UV light, and boiling at 120oC for 15 minutes.

Bacteria Survival

20

2 TYPES OF BACTERIA:

•Bacteria - consumer

-Get food from an outside source

•Blue-green Bacteria - autotrophic

-Make their own food

21

Bacteria Survival – Food sources

parasites – bacteria that feed on living things

saprophytes – use dead materials for food

(exclusively)

decomposers – get food from breaking down

dead matter into simple chemicals

important- because they send minerals

and other materials back into the soil so

other organisms can use them

Controlling Bacteria

3 ways to control bacteria:

1) Canning- the process of sealing food in airtight cans or jars after killing bacteria

•endospores are killed during this process

2) Pasteurization- process of heating milk to kill harmful bacteria

3) Dehydration- removing water from food

•Bacteria can’t grow when H2O is removed

•example: uncooked noodles & cold cereal

28

Controlling Bacteria Antiseptic vs. Disinfectants

Antiseptic- chemicals that kill bacteria on living things

•means – “against infection”

Examples: iodine, hydrogen peroxide, alcohol, soap, mouthwash

Disinfectants- stronger chemicals that destroy bacteria on objects or nonliving things

BLUE-GREEN BACTERIA

Autotrophs – make their own food through photosynthesis

commonly grow on water and surfaces that stay wet…such as rivers, creeks and dams

larger than most bacterial cells

Some live in salt water, snow, and acid water of hot springs

food source for animals that live in the water

31

BLUE-GREEN BACTERIA

Blooms- occur when the bacteria multiplies in great numbers and form scum on the top of the water

can be toxic to humans and animals
